 Exhibition at the Town Hall: “Stader Impressions”

Stefan Schmarje is exhibiting his paintings in the foyer of the New Town Hall in Stade.

After Stefan Schmarje presented works by his students at the Town Hall in Stade last year, he is now showcasing his own creations. Under the title “Stader Impressions,” around 20 works by the Stade painter can be seen. Predominantly in oil and acrylic techniques, he depicts various views of Stade.

Schmarje moves across the entire spectrum of artistic styles from realism, impressionism, and expressionism to abstraction. His paintings aim to create a connection between art and the viewer, between the visible and emotions.

Stefan Schmarje worked in various professions before he took the step into artistic self-employment over 20 years ago. Several years of intensive painting study at the “Worpswede Painting Studio” under Lothar Schulz-Goldap paved the way to his own painting school and his establishment as an artist.

The art exhibition can be seen from June 5, 2026, to July 3, 2026, in the foyer of the New Town Hall in Stade. The opening reception begins on Thursday, June 4, at 7 p.m. Advance registration is requested by Wednesday, June 3, via kultur@stadt-stade.de or 04141/401-411.
